Costs & Financial Aid

In-state tuition at University of Maine is $13,326 and out-of-state tuition is $36,756. After financial aid, the average net price is $17,510. About 23.3% of students receive Pell Grants.

Outcomes & Earnings

Graduates of University of Maine earn a median salary of $48,653 ten years after enrollment. The graduation rate is 55.7%. Median student debt at graduation is $25,000, with an estimated monthly loan payment of $265.

Student Body

University of Maine has 8,496 undergraduate students. The student body is 48.3% female. About 23.4% are first-generation college students. The average age at entry is 20.2.
